东莞建网站的公司,怎样修改网站标题,介休市网站建设公司,做招聘网站需要做什么公司## 1最近在学docker部署#xff0c;一开始打算将nginx先docker化的。对照官方的docker镜像介绍说明#xff0c;进行自定义配置将官方的nginx.conf复制出来后#xff0c;修改添加了一些自定义#xff0c;主要是屏蔽了default.conf#xff0c;以及include文件夹 sites-avail…## 1最近在学docker部署一开始打算将nginx先docker化的。对照官方的docker镜像介绍说明进行自定义配置将官方的nginx.conf复制出来后修改添加了一些自定义主要是屏蔽了default.conf以及include文件夹 sites-available# include /etc/nginx/conf.d/.conf;include /etc/nginx/sites-available/;官方原先配置user nginx;worker_processes 1;error_log /var/log/nginx/error.log warn;pid /var/run/nginx.pid;events {worker_connections 1024;}http {include /etc/nginx/mime.types;default_type application/octet-stream;log_format main $remote_addr - $remote_user [$time_local] $request $status $body_bytes_sent $http_referer $http_user_agent $http_x_forwarded_for;access_log /var/log/nginx/access.log main;sendfile on;#tcp_nopush on;keepalive_timeout 65;#gzip on;include /etc/nginx/conf.d/*.conf;}新建docker-compose.yml 简单的 指定images名字端口挂载本地文件替代默认version: 3services:nginx-proxy:image: nginxcontainer_name: nginxports:- 8081:80volumes:- ./nginx/nginx.conf:/etc/nginx/nginx.conf:ro## 2运行docker-compose up 后一直卡在attaching to nginx浏览器也是无法访问该端口地址Starting nginx ... doneAttaching to nginx不知道问题出在哪里查找资料后发现可以使用tty参数进行调试。修改docker-compose.yml增加一个配置tty:true。docker exec -it nginx /bin/bash发现自己把默认的default.conf删除后没有添加其他的配置文件之前的sites-available文件夹是空的。## 3自己把自己坑了添加-./nginx/sites-available:/etc/nginx/sites-available:ro并在sites-available添加一个配置文件。/etc/nginx/sites-available# lsdefault.conf运行后对端口地址访问终于正常了以上就是本文的全部内容希望对大家的学习有所帮助也希望大家多多支持我们。本文标题: docker nginx 运行后无法访问的问题解决本文地址: http://www.cppcns.com/jiqiao/fuwuqi/240332.html